Great informative video. I learned years ago by going out after season looking for rubs and scrapes where they went. I also went out during spring greenup and found the oak trees and apple trees and seen all the traffic sign. Noted ok heres where they went at one point. That helped me tremendously in both understanding how their needs change and how they adapt to what makes them comfortable. Thicker cover and higher stem count woody browse once they shed their velvet where they can't be there during the summers or it will hurt them when they hit the velvet. Most people think about the daylight lessening only affecting does and their estrous cycle. It absolutely affects bucks also. Great timing for this video! Goodluck to you Mr Woods!

Great video man. Just one thing I disagree with. If buck weren’t territorial then why do they come in to the grunts and rattles? Or get aggressive when they smell another bucks urine
@GrowingDeerTV
@GrowingDeerTV 11 месяцев назад
They come to grunts because a grunt signals a receptive doe. They come to dance and not fight. Urine - they certainly don't become aggressive every time they smell buck urine but do sometimes do if there's any sign of a receptive doe nearby.

I’m confused.. if bucks don’t become “territorial” then why do smaller bucks seem to come around less often or disappear altogether when a mature buck comes into the picture during the rut?
@GrowingDeerTV
@GrowingDeerTV 11 месяцев назад
I often see young bucks with mature bucks. Bucks certainly fight over receptive does but don't defend territories.
